1. INTRODUCTION

The COMESA Competition Commission (the “CCC”) is a regional competition authority established under Article 6 of the COMESA Competition Regulations (the “Regulations”). It enjoys an independent legal personality. It may acquire, hold and dispose of property and assets. It may sue and be sued in its corporate name. 

The CCC is mandated to promote and encourage competition by preventing restrictive business practices that deter the efficient operation of markets, thereby enhancing the welfare of consumers in the Common Market for Eastern and Southern Africa (the “Common Market”) and to protect consumers against offensive conduct by market actors. 

The CCC is hereby seeking to procure the services of a suitably qualified and competent Consultancy Firm to manage the Construction of the CCC Office Building (the “Project”) from inception to completion including any related aspects.

The Consultancy Firm shall work under the supervision of an “Internal Building Committee” established by the CCC. The Internal Building Committee shall represent the CCC in all matters related to the Project.

The Terms of Reference (“TORs”) for the Consultancy Services are set out in the sections below: 

2.0. SCOPE OF SERVICES REQUIRED

The Consultancy Firm shall perform all the services necessary to execute the Project from inception to completion. Among the services required shall include: 

  1. Assist in the preparation of tender documentation for the various services required by the CCC to facilitate the Construction of the Office Building and incorporation of all the bidding requirements into the documentation.
  2. Evaluation of tender documents and assist the CCC in the award of tenders.
  3. Preparation of detailed artistic impressions which shall include the Structural and Civil Engineering Design for the Office Building.
  4. Supervise the Construction of the Office Building from inception to completion through comprehensive inspections’ analysis, collection of data, and interviews with relevant stakeholders, among others.
  5. Incorporation of advice and comments from the CCC into the designing and construction of the Office Building.
  6. Any matter connected and incidental to the foregoing.

A more comprehensive description of the works is presented below. 

3.0. OFFICE BLOCK ACCOMODATION REQUIREMENTS

The Office Building will be located in the City of Lilongwe on Plot Number 34/527 in Area 34 whose approximate site is 1.249 hectares. The Site Plan shall be made available to the Consultancy Firm for reference.

The Office Building is contemplated to comprise five (5) floors, two (2) of which shall be occupied by the CCC Staff and the COMESA Competition Training Law Centre. It intended that the remainder of the three (3) floors shall be leased out to prospective clients.

6.0. TENDER PROCEDURES FOR WORKS

The tender procedures for the works shall be guided by the CCC’s Procurement Rules which shall be communicated to the Contractor. The Consultancy Firm shall prepare eight (8) sets of tender documents and issue them to the CCC and if requested to do so will issue them to companies who apply for them.

During the tender period, the Consultancy Firm shall organise and conduct an official visit to the site and a pre-tender conference, which will be attended by prospective tenderers. Tenderers will be availed an opportunity to ask questions at these sessions and the Consultancy Firm will record the questions and prepare written answers to the questions and circulate both to all tenderers.

7.0. EVALUATION OF TENDERS 

The Consultancy Firm will be required to assist the CCC in evaluating the tenders which shall be done in line with the CCC’s Procurement Rules.

On receipt of the tenders, the Consultancy Firm will carry out an arithmetic check on all tenders received and report any corrections of the tender sums to the CCC.

It will then carry out a full analysis of all the tenders, in accordance with the CCC Procurement Rules and shall consider the following, among other things:

 ➢ The rates and prices

➢ Programmes

➢ Methods of constructions

 ➢ Plant

 ➢ Personnel

➢ Financing of the works

The Consultancy Firm shall present results of its analysis in a report to the CCC with recommendations for award of contract(s) within 45 days of receipt of documents. It should provide full substantiation of its recommendation and advise on the issue, which should be clarified in negotiations with the tenderer(s) to explore if and/or when possibilities of reducing/downgrading the quantities and/or design specifications or launching a new tender.
